One of the reasons that I'm thinking the driver support is inadequate is because Nvidia SLI detection tool does not recognise the Q706 as having SLI enabled
-
Has anyone been able to get an answer about why the 706 Toshibas are not reporting as SLI? I sent a question in to Toshiba about it, but, no answer yet, and its been a few weeks. I don't own one currently, but the complete functionality of the sli is one of the deciding factors between this and a 725 msi.
-
"Hybrid SLI Technology
NVIDIA Hybrid SLI® technology combines the graphics processing power of the GeForce 9400M G motherboard GPU with a second GeForce GPU to increase the visual and gaming performance and extend the battery life of your notebook."
http://www.nvidia.co.uk/object/geforce_9400m_g_mgpu_uk.html
I think thats what is going on with the Q706, the benchmarking score just don't add up to dual 9800m gts. RivaTuner 2.22 shows the second GPU as an unattached device which suggests that there is no driver support for the second GPU sli functionality. Even Nvidia system tools system details reports 9400m g sli. Nvidia sli zone detection tool reports sli is not enabled. One of the 9800m gts's is always 3-4 degrees celsius hotter than the other.
The question is, will we ever get drivers support for dual 9800m gts sli, which is what we thought we were paying for? It still runs games pretty good, but my decision to purchase this laptop was based on dual 9800m gts functionality. -
I doubt that we will ever have dual 9800m gts functionality, it will always be a combination of 9400m g motherboard gpu and 1 9800m gts. What good is having 2 9800m gts's--marketing gimmick?
